Major Trends
- Hygiene and Health Focus – Following heightened awareness from the pandemic, airlines invested in lavatory systems with UV sanitation, touchless faucets, and advanced airflow systems.
- Space Optimization – With cabin space at a premium, lavatory systems were redesigned to minimize footprint without compromising accessibility. Innovations like “Space-Flex” modules in Airbus aircraft exemplify this trend.
- Sustainability Initiatives – Vacuum-based flushing systems significantly reduce water consumption, cutting weight and improving fuel efficiency. Eco-friendly materials further reinforced the green push.
- Accessibility Upgrades – Larger lavatories, especially on wide-body aircraft, became more common, aligning with the U.S. DOT’s requirements for passengers with reduced mobility.
Competitive Landscape
Leading suppliers, including Safran, Jamco, and Diehl, leveraged modular design and smart engineering to strengthen their positions. Competition was also fueled by partnerships, such as OEM collaborations to integrate lavatory modules directly into new aircraft platforms.

Regional Breakdown
- North America remained the largest market, shaped by regulatory compliance and strong airline modernization programs.
- Asia-Pacific posted the fastest growth, supported by airline expansions in China, India, and Southeast Asia.
- Europe emphasized technological sophistication, with Airbus programs leading demand for advanced lavatory systems.
Market Challenges
Cost remained a major barrier, particularly for retrofitting older fleets with new lavatory solutions. Airlines operating narrow-body aircraft also struggled with balancing space efficiency against regulatory requirements for accessibility.
